Another important aspect of the *etiquette* is to greet everyone, not just those you know. This is a core teaching in Islam, emphasizing the importance of extending greetings to both familiar and unfamiliar people. It is about treating everyone with respect and kindness. By doing so, you're creating a welcoming environment and demonstrating that you value everyone, regardless of your relationship with them. In addition to the verbal aspects of greeting, there are also non-verbal cues that enhance the interaction. These include smiling, making eye contact, and showing a positive body language.
